Restaurants: Mediterranean West Hollywood

Ramma Geni Cafe

Address
8500 Melrose Ave
Place
West Hollywood , CA 90069-5168
Landline
(310) 855-1777

Description

Ramma Geni Cafe can be found at 8500 Melrose Ave . The following is offered: Restaurants: Mediterranean - In West Hollywood there are 6 other Restaurants: Mediterranean. An overview can be found here.

Reviews

This listing was not reviewed yet

Categories

Restaurants: Mediterranean
(310)855-1777 (310)-855-1777 +13108551777

Map 8500 Melrose Ave